Your Tree's History
The development era of your home, the 2000s, directly influences your tree issues today. Landscaping from that period often favored fast-growing species to provide quick curb appeal. Many of these, like the commonly planted Russian Olive or Green Ash, are now classified as problem species. They may be reaching the end of their structural integrity or are highly susceptible to the borers we see in the county. Furthermore, trees planted 24 years ago without proper structural pruning are now mature trees with codominant stems and weak branch unions, making them vulnerable during our occasional but intense storm events.

Active Tree Threats in Amador County
Sudden Oak Death (SOD) critical in coastal areas
Affects: Tanoak (most lethal), coast live oak, California black oak, Shreve oak, and 100+ other species as carriers
Water mold (Phytophthora ramorum) that causes cankers on oak trunks, leading to rapid death. Spread by rain splash from infected bay laurel leaves. Has killed millions of oaks and tanoaks since 1990s.
Invasive Shot Hole Borers (ISHB/KSHB) high
Affects: 100+ species - sycamores, box elder, coast live oak, avocado, willows, maples most affected
Tiny ambrosia beetles that bore into trees and introduce a Fusarium fungus they farm for food. The fungus clogs the tree's vascular system (Fusarium dieback). Entry holes are tiny (< 1mm) but staining on bark is visible.
Goldspotted Oak Borer high in San Diego
Affects: Coast live oak, California black oak, canyon live oak
Beetle native to Arizona/Mexico that has established in Southern California. Larvae bore under bark of oaks, killing branches and eventually the tree. First detected 2004, has killed >80,000 oaks in San Diego.
